Transaction 57ddb86786bc0f497b2995c9b20d3bc7e7a285009b910d682226019e340546d2

1 Input
2 Outputs
  • 57ddb86786bc0f497b2995c9b20d3bc7e7a285009b910d682226019e340546d2:0
  • value  201539
    address  32J4V8qCL2xWL8iUUyNHfFvXQYBWUw5mXV
  • 57ddb86786bc0f497b2995c9b20d3bc7e7a285009b910d682226019e340546d2:1
  • value  1664740146
    address  34AfAP7KQGtw9suSx45er4JpDzAaQcA6Gd